Abstract: A novel Krebs -type polyoxometalate [Na10 (H2 O)26 ][Sb2 W20 Zn2 O70 (H2 O)6 ]{Zn2 W2 } (1) was fabricated from one-pot transformations of the trilacunary Keggin -type [B-α-SbW9 O33 ] 9− precursor, followed by Zn 2+ /Na + -assisted self-assembly of the Krebs -type polyanion. The{Zn2 W2 } polyanion was further self-assembled into 3D architecture with new topology by adjusting Na + cations. The compound{Zn2 W2 } (1) was fully characterized with a wide range of analytical methods, including single crystal/powder X-ray diffraction, thermogravimetric analysis (TGA) and various spectroscopic techniques (FT-IR, Raman, UV–vis). Electrochemical performance of{Zn2 W2 } polyanion was also investigated by cyclic voltammetry (CV) in sodium acetate buffer solution. Moreover, compound{Zn2 W2 } (1) is an effective catalyst for the oxidation of cyclohexanol with hydrogen peroxide.
